- # TODO handle more than full namespaces.
- redef fun answer(request, url) do
- var namespace = request.param("namespace")
- if namespace == null or namespace.is_empty then
- return render_error(400, "Missing :namespace.")
- end
- var model = init_model_view(request)
- var mentities = model.mentities_by_namespace(namespace)
- if mentities.is_empty then
- return render_error(404, "No mentity matching this namespace.")
+ redef fun get(req, res) do
+ var namespace = req.param("namespace")
+ var model = init_model_view(req)
+ var mentity = find_mentity(model, namespace)
+ if mentity == null then
+ res.error(404)
+ return